在《魔兽争霸3》地图的创作过程中,地图文件的大小问题一直是众多地图制作者需要面对的挑战。特别是在文件大小超过4M时,可能会影响玩家的下载速度和运行体验。有效地压缩和优化地图文件,不仅可以使玩家更容易访问和分享地图,还可以提升游戏的整体流畅度。本文将分享一些实用的解决方案,帮助地图制作者有效降低地图的文件大小。
首先,合理利用自定义材质和音效是优化地图文件大小的重要方法。通常情况下,自定义的材质和音效文件会占用大量的存储空间,因此制作者可以选择删除那些冗余的资源,或者替换成更为精简的版本。此外,使用最大化压缩的格式来保存这些资源,比如将音效文件转换成较低比特率的MP3格式,或使用PNG格式保存材质文件,都会有效减少文件大小。
其次,合理的地形设计也能影响地图文件的大小。在《魔兽争霸3》中,地形的复杂程度直接关系到地图文件的体积。地图制作者应当对地形进行简化,去掉那些不必要的细节,比如过多的装饰物和复杂的地形变化。设计时保持合理的可玩性和美观性,同时还要兼顾文件大小,这样可以达到压缩文件的目的而不影响游戏体验。
另外,使用触发器时,要尽可能地优化代码。复杂的触发器和过多的事件调用不仅会让人物的行为变得不自然,还会增加地图的总大小。地图制作者可以通过合并重复的功能、简化触发器逻辑,以及使用更为高效的编程方式来减小触发器所占用的空间。此外,考虑将部分重用的触发器和功能模块化,以相对较小的脚本文件进行调用,这不仅能够优化地图大小,还可以提高地图运行的效率。
最后,进行最终打包和压缩时,可以借助各种地图编辑工具和压缩软件。如使用《魔兽争霸3》自带的“保存压缩”功能,能够在保存文件的同时自动将地图进行压缩;此外,还可以使用WinRAR等第三方工具进行再度压缩。在这些工具中,选择适合的压缩方式和参数设定,是减少文件大小的关键。
综上所述,优化《魔兽争霸3》地图的文件大小是一个综合性的问题。通过合理利用资源、优化地形设计、精简触发器代码以及使用压缩工具等手段,可以确保地图在保持良好体验的同时,减少不必要的文件体积。希望这些技巧能够帮助地图制作者们更高效地创作出出色的地图,提升玩家的游戏乐趣。